it's normal to get booted back into sysNAND when exiting settings.
And no it shouldn't, it will only say RX-S if you launched rxTool & it boots into sysnand (instead of emunand)
So how do you know you're safely in EmuNAND? I'm on 7.2 ATM so I can't install themes; all I can do is move the icons around in EmuNAND so I can tell the difference. I still feel paranoid when it comes to updating though.
when you launch rxTool and it boots into emunand it will say RX-E
create a folder called emunand in emunand and other called sysnand in sysnand
